Transaction 425011ee89491c2b0951fd188fe3cc4d44de11b6fb11b69204061af1c814377a
1 Input
2 Outputs
- 425011ee89491c2b0951fd188fe3cc4d44de11b6fb11b69204061af1c814377a:0
- 425011ee89491c2b0951fd188fe3cc4d44de11b6fb11b69204061af1c814377a:1
value 408763
address 34mfpkYYgqFdHUFFdddTvTN13TbPLCeh1Q
value 21793775
address 1B5ga4qV2Lkc5Vv2YzXgrRP54LxScAkVYk